Why not just upgrade the main panel instead?
Sub panel installation costs $1,200-$2,500 compared to $3,500-$8,000 for main panel upgrades. If your main panel has adequate capacity for your home plus the addition, sub panels provide targeted expansion more efficiently. We evaluate your total electrical load to recommend the most cost-effective solution—sometimes that’s sub panels, sometimes main panel upgrade.

What about future electrical needs beyond this project?
Sub panels can include expansion capacity for future needs within the specific area they serve. If you’re planning a workshop now but might add an EV charger later, we can size the sub panel accordingly. Strategic sub panel planning accommodates growth without requiring immediate overinvestment.
Will this meet electrical code requirements?
Sub panel installation must meet current NEC and local electrical codes. We ensure proper grounding, appropriate overcurrent protection, and correct conductor sizing. All work includes inspection approval and code compliance documentation for insurance and resale purposes.
